Recognizing Playgroup Dynamics and Size



When choosing a canine day care, understanding playgroup dynamics and size is important for your pet dog's well-being. A well-balanced playgroup improves socialization and minimizes tension for your pet dog.

Search for centers that team pet dogs by dimension, personality, and power degrees. Smaller playgroups usually give a lot more specific focus, while bigger groups can use diverse socialization opportunities.

Observe just how staff oversees communications; they should keep an eye on play carefully and step in if required. It's vital to make certain that your pet feels comfy and secure amongst their buddies.

Ask about the day care's method to presenting new pet dogs and dealing with conflicts. Ultimately, the best environment fosters positive interactions, assisting your fuzzy friend grow.

Checking for Health and Vaccination Demands



What can be more crucial than your dog's wellness when picking a daycare? Before enlisting your fuzzy buddy, ensure the facility needs updated inoculations. Common inoculations consist of rabies, Bordetella, and distemper.

Ask for a copy of their health and wellness plan and look for any kind of extra needs, like flea and tick prevention.

It's important to guarantee that the day care screens pet dogs for wellness concerns, as this helps avoid the spread of health problem. Ask about their protocol for handling unwell canines and just how they manage any possible episodes.

A responsible daycare must focus on the health and wellness of all animals. By validating these wellness needs, you'll assist develop a safe setting for your pet dog and various other hairy companions.

Taking Into Consideration Location, Hours, and Rates



Choosing the appropriate pet day care involves more than just examining tasks; you additionally need to take into consideration place, hours, and pricing.

Beginning by checking exactly how close the day care is to your home or workplace-- convenience can make drop-offs and pick-ups trouble-free. Next, consider the hours of procedure. Make sure they straighten with your schedule, particularly if you function lengthy hours or have uneven shifts.

Finally, review the pricing structure. Some day cares charge each day, while others provide plans or discount rates for longer dedications. Ensure you recognize what's included in the expense, like dishes or added tasks.

Balancing these factors will certainly help you find a day care that fits both your requirements and your fuzzy friend's way of life.
